Source data are provided as a Source Data file. a A-to-I editome of distant-clustered ROIs show preserved A-to-I signatures. b Tree with height clustered with physical distance between ROIs (left) and distribution of these clusters in the tissue. c A heatmap of single-base RNA editing event in selected genes related to iron mediation. d Volcano plot of fold change values of genes in samples with A-to-I-edited GPX4 variants compared to those without the variant. Microniches from four TNBC tissues (from patients B, C, D, and E) were analyzed. Blue dots indicate ferroptosis-related genes, red dots indicate upregulated genes in CSCs, and green dots indicate downregulated genes in CSCs.
